Event Information
Pittcon 2007 Conference & Expo
Date: Sunday, February 25 through Thursday, March 1
Location: McCormick Place, Chicago, Illinois

Pittcon 2007 will comprise five day's worth of invited symposia, workshops, new product forums, and contributed oral and poster sessions to provide a comprehensive coverage of the latest developments in the traditional and emerging disciplines of analytical chemistry and applied spectroscopy.

Plenary Lecture
Dr. Charles Lieber will present Sunday, February 25, “Nanowire Nanoelectronic Devices for Detection of and Interfacing to Biological Systems” at 4:30 p.m. in room S100BC.

Dr. Lieber, the Mark Hyman Jr. Professor of Chemistry at Harvard University, holds joint appointments in the Department of Chemistry and Chemical Biology and the Division of Engineering and Applied Sciences. He is best known for his pioneering experimental work in molecular nanotechnology, including the synthesis and characterization of the unique physical properties of carbon nanotubes and nanowires. continue

ACS Co-Programming with Pittcon
New this year, the American Chemical Society Division of Analytical Chemistry will be co-programming with The Pittsburgh Conference. This will involve several invited symposia and contributed sessions, as well as some poster sessions. Major focus areas will include bioanalytical chemistry, pharmaceutical chemistry, nanotechnology, environmental chemistry, forensic analysis, life science technologies, food analysis, applied molecular spectroscopy, mass spectrometry and chemical separations.continue
